Tonbridge Location - Tonbridge is a thriving market town that has developed over the centuries. It boasts a fine example of a 'Motte and Bailey' Norman castle built in the 13th century, set on the banks of the river Medway with the castle grounds abutting Tonbridge Park offering covered/open air swimming pool, tennis courts, children's play areas, miniature railway, putting etc. Tonbridge town offers an excellent range of retail and leisure activities with many High Street stores and a full complement of banks and building societies, together with a selection of coffee shops, restaurants and local inns. The mainline station provides fast commuter links into London (Cannon Street/London Bridge/Charing Cross in approximately 40 minutes) with road links to the M20 & M25 motorways via the nearby A26 and A21. Tonbridge offers a full scale of education from Nursery to College and includes Grammar & Private schools such as the well-renowned Tonbridge School. There are many places of historical interest in the surrounding areas including Penshurst Place and Gardens, Hever Castle, Knole House and Chartwell (once home to Winston Churchill).

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:
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s
The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:
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
